Our Courses

Your Program is broken down into 4 Courses:

  • Beginner’s Course
  • Lower-Intermediate Course
  • Upper-Intermediate Course
  • Advanced Course

Each Course consists of 5 Levels. Each Level consists of a 6 week intensive program (3 hours of Lecture time per week) or a 12 week regular program (1.5 hours of Lecture time per week).

Our classes are intentionally small, with a maximum class size of 10-12 students. This provides an opportunity for frequent and meaningful student-to-teacher and student-to-student interaction

and immersion. Our classes are offered on a rolling basis so once we determine your skill level, you can enrol in any class that suits your schedule. All you have to do is provide us with a series of times and weekdays that you are available and we will do the utmost to accommodate your schedule. What further distinguishes our school from other online schools is that we provide hand-in assignments and tests throughout each course, and will provide you with online face-to-face feedback on each test or assignment to ensure that you fully understand the material we have covered. Once you complete our Program, you should be proficient in Russian.

ADVANCED LEVEL

Conducted in Russian, this course uses interactive approach and offers advanced practice in oral work and written composition. The goal is to raise the linguistic skills of the students to the intermediate-advanced threshold and maximally enrich students’ vocabulary. 

 Variety of resources are used in the course to facilitate the understanding of cultural complexities, including folk, classical and modern literature, music and song lyrics, poetry, art, drama, newspaper, magazine, radio and Internet reports, film and cartoons.
